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all be installed in strict compliance with applicable Building Code.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all be installed with a minimum 4-inch head lap in a shingle layer fashion.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all be fastened with Miami -Dade approved corrosion resistant tin -caps and 12 gauge 1 '/4"
annular ring -shank nails, spaced 6" o.c. at all laps and three staggered rows fastened 12" o.c. in the field of the
roll.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ments may be used with Asphaltic shingles, Wood shakes and shingles, Non-structural metal roofing,
and quarry slate.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ium
UDL25 Synthetic Underlayments shall not be used as roof tile underlayments.
For Roof Tile.applications; may be used as an anchor sheet in roof tile applications when used in combination
with a top membrane layer, consisting of a Miami -Dade approved TAS 103 self -adhering underlayment. (See
current NOA listing of approved TAS 103 self -adhering underlayment for installation guidelines and
limitations of use).
For fire classification of specific roof assemblies using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of
U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ic Underlayments refer to a current Approved Roofing
Materials Directory for fire ratings of this product.

Fire classification is not part of this acceptance; refer to a current Approved Roofing Materials Directory for
fire ratings of this product.
This acceptance is for prepared roofing applications. Minimum deck requirements shall be in compliance with
applicable building code.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all be applied to a smooth, clean and dry surface with deck free of irregularities. All nails in
the deck shall be carefully checked for protruding heads. Re -fasten any loose decking panels. Sweep the deck
thoroughly to remove any dust and debris prior to application.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all not be hot mopped, refer to manufacturer's published literature for product compatibility.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all not be applied over an existing roof membrane as a recover system.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ments shall not be left exposed as a temporary roof for longer than 30 days of application.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ments are components used in roof system assemblies. Roof system assemblies are approved under a
specific Notice of Acceptance. Refer to Prepared Roofing system Product Control Notice of Acceptance for
listed approval of this product with specific prepared roofing products.
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ic
Underlayments may be used with any approved roof covering Notice of Acceptance listing Titanium® UDL-
30, Titanium® UDL-50, R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ic Underlayments as
a component part of an assembly in the Notice of Acceptance. If Titanium® UDL-30, Titanium® UDL-50,
RhinoRoof U10, RhinoRoof U20, and Titanium UDL25 Synthetic Underlayments are not listed, a request may
be made to the Authority Having Jurisdiction (AHJ) or the Miami -Dade County Product Control Department
for approval provided that appropriate documentation is provided to detail compatibility of the products, wind
uplift resistance, and fire testing results.
